Pakistan home to 12 foreign terrorist organisations: report
The Hindu
Congressional Research Service report categories groups into five types — globally-oriented, Afghanistan oriented, India - and Kashmir-oriented, domestically oriented, and Sectarian (anti-Shia).
Pakistan is home to at least 12 groups designated as ‘foreign terrorist organisations’, including five of them being India-centric like and Jaish-e-Mohammed, according to a latest Congressional report on terrorism.

US officials have identified Pakistan as a base of operations or target for numerous , some of which have existed since the 1980s, the independent Congressional Research Service (CRS) said in the report.
